Block

#18,935,781
Block Number
18,935,781 @ 06/26/2024, 08:09:00
Status
Finalizing
ID
0x0120efe56eea461235cedb28259b4070456a477112f96aac1737933dedd672af
Transactions
Gas Used
0/40000000 (0.00% Used)
Total Score
159,651,577 (+14)
Rewards
0.00 VTHO